Commercial Slab Installation in Spartanburg, SC
Commercial slab installation services involve preparing and pouring concrete slabs that serve as foundational surfaces for various types of structures. These projects often include building foundations for warehouses, retail stores, restaurants, or other commercial facilities. Property owners typically want to understand the process involved, the durability of the finished slab, and how the installation supports the overall stability and longevity of their building. Proper preparation, including site grading and reinforcement, is essential to ensure the slab can withstand daily use and environmental factors.
Before requesting commercial slab installation, property owners should consider the specific requirements of their project, such as load-bearing capacity, size, and any necessary concrete specifications. It’s also helpful to understand the importance of proper drainage and the role of reinforcement materials like rebar or wire mesh. Clear communication about the intended use and future plans for the space can help ensure the installation meets all structural needs and complies with local building standards.

Commercial Slab Installation Questions
What types of projects require commercial slab installation? Commercial slab installation is commonly used for building foundations, parking lots, loading docks, and storage areas on commercial properties in Spartanburg and nearby areas.
What should property owners consider before installing a concrete slab? It’s important to evaluate soil conditions, drainage needs, and the intended use of the space to ensure proper design and durability of the slab.
How does the thickness of a commercial slab vary? The thickness depends on the load requirements and purpose of the slab, with heavier loads requiring thicker concrete for stability and longevity.
What are common surface finishes for commercial slabs? Surface finishes can include smooth, broomed, or textured surfaces, chosen based on safety, aesthetics, and functionality needs for the project.
